Description
Located on a quiet residential turning just off Chiswick High Road, this well-proportioned two-bedroom ground floor flat offers approximately 582 sq ft (54.1 sq m) of internal living space and is held on a long lease with approximately 946 years remaining. The property is offered with no onward chain, presenting an appealing opportunity for first-time buyers, downsizers, or rental investors seeking a long-term asset in a prime West London setting.
The accommodation comprises a bright bay-fronted reception room positioned at the front of the flat, providing excellent natural light and a generous seating area. A separate, fully fitted kitchen sits adjacent, offering practical workspace and scope for personalisation. The flat includes two bedrooms—one double and one single—as well as a generously sized, well-appointed bathroom, all arranged on a single level within a period-style converted building. The layout provides a comfortable and functional flow for everyday living, with classic period features and scope to update if desired.
Situated in a desirable pocket of W4, British Grove is a peaceful street within immediate reach of the shops, cafés, and restaurants of Chiswick High Road. Popular destinations such as Gail’s Bakery, High Road House, and various independent boutiques and national supermarkets are all within walking distance. The property enjoys strong transport connectivity, with Stamford Brook Underground Station (District Line) located just 0.2 miles away, and Turnham Green and Ravenscourt Park stations both within 0.4 miles, offering fast and direct access into Central London. For green spaces, Chiswick Common and Ravenscourt Park are within easy walking distance, ideal for recreation and leisure. The A4/M4 corridor is also easily accessible, providing swift road links to Heathrow Airport and the West.
